“Opal – Symbol of Hope and Happiness”
Opal is a beautiful gemstone given as a symbol of hope, trust and Happiness. It derived its name from the Latin word opalus, which means “seeing jewel”. It is also believed to derive its name from a Sanskrit word upala, which means simply a stone. An opal along with tourmaline is the birthstone for the month of October and is also a stone for Zodiac Sign Libra. It is the anniversary stone for the 14th and 18th years of marriage.
Today’s supply of opal mainly comes from Mexico, United States and Australia. More than 90% of the world's quality opals come from Southern Australia. But can also be found in other parts of the world such as Brazil, Czechoslovakia, Nevada and Idaho.

From semi-transparent to opaque Opal occurs in different colors. The Crystal or water ones have a colorless body; the white ones are the most common ones. Black opal has a dark blue, gray, or black body color and these are the most valued ones. Boulder opal combines precious opal with the ironstone in which it forms. Bright yellow, orange, or red fire opals are quite different from the other varieties of opal. Translucent to transparent tones of these stones are beautiful with or without play of color.
